Question 1987 560SL Power Door Lock

The power door lock on the driver's side of our 560SL operates when the key is turned on the passenger side, and also works when the lock is manually pressed in on the passenger side. However, when the key is turned on the driver's side, the power lock does not activate on either door. Likewise, when the lock is pressed in manually on the drivers side. I am guessing there is a loose connection or switch failure. Questions for this group (from a pretty limited mechanic)

-how do I access the inside of the door?
-anyone know if there is a part that can be replaced without installing a new lock and motor?

Hi , If you do a Fourm search for "Door Panel Removal" you will find step by step instructions. After you get them off look for disconnected vacuum lines.

But first how does the locking system work from the trunk? there are many lines that go to the vacuum pump on the passenger side under the gas cap door. lines that come from the trunk lock and fuel door are these working? Find the pump and see if every line is connected and the trunk and fuel door lock and unlock. if hey do then it is on to the door panels. Removing the panels is best done with a wedge they will help you remove the door clips. The door panels are make from a thick pressboard that over the years has probably gotten soft and must be handled carefully. Be gentle with all removals and don't loose the trim screws they are hard to replace.

Also first remove ,very carefully the two triangular chrome/plastic covers that are inside at the connection of the driving mirrors. that is the first thing you remove very carefully as to not break the little plastic hooks that hold it in place

Forum search and the first posting of photo info will be a great help.
